This guide aims to provide supportive, practical information to help you navigate your next steps with confidence and hope.\n\nThe foundation of effective alcohol addiction treatment is a personalized approach. Recovery is not one-size-fits-all, and the best programs will assess your unique physical, psychological, and social needs. For residents of Clayton, this often means looking toward larger regional centers in cities like Colby, Hays, or even into neighboring states like Colorado or Nebraska, which may offer a wider range of services. These can include medical detoxification to safely manage withdrawal symptoms, inpatient residential programs for intensive, structured care, and outpatient programs that allow you to maintain work or family commitments while receiving therapy. When researching facilities, consider whether they offer evidence-based therapies like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), which helps reshape thought patterns, and whether they address co-occurring mental health conditions, which are common alongside addiction.\n\nBeyond formal rehab centers, your local community in Clayton and Sherman County holds invaluable recovery resources.
